2.5 or 3:1 INT ratio, have to see him demonstrate that he can consistently hit guys at the top of their routes. Needs to minimize the fumbles as well.

Show that he can read and understand zone defense....he just flat out can't from what I've seen so far and that is death for a qb.

Dramatically lower his time to throw.... there's no reason for a lower tier athleticism guy like him to have a TTT over three seconds, he's not peak Deshaun and he needs to stop trying to play like he is. League average is like 2.3 seconds and Shedeur was around 3.6.

I need to see him be this cerebral "TB12" style QB that he's promised to be multiple times through college and the draft process, instead of this immobile mobile QB that he tries to be. It was entertaining and kinda worked in college but it won't work in the pros.
